Review: Noreve Tradition Leather Case for iPod nano
Two of the leather cases, PDair s Flip Type Leather Case ($25) and Noreve s Tradition Leather Case ($40), are based on the same general idea: cover the new iPod nano in leather, using a bottom-opening flap to cover its face, Dock Connector, and Hold switch part time. Both cases use magnetic clasps to hold the flaps closed, and though they offer similar levels of protection each one exposes nano s headphone port and corners,
